India Details
Important Arrival Information
Volunteers should plan to arrive between 10AM on the start date of the program and 10AM on the following day. You can arrive earlier than that, but there will be an additional charge for a hotel room.
Included in the Program fee:
- All meals
- Accommodation
- Airport Transfers. Volunteers must fly into New Delhi Airport for the Rajasthan and Himachal Programs and Mumbai for the Goa Program.
- Transportation between your accommodation and work site.
- Excursions, including jungle treks, visits to historic temples and a one week Ashram stay (for Goa volunteers). More details upon request.
- Cultural activities, inlcuding yoga lessons and Indian cooking lessons
- Detailed on site orientation
- Full Coordination on site and extensive pre-departure preparation information and materials
- All Materials required for volunteer activities
- First night in a hotel if you arrive on the start date of the program.
- Comprehensive Emergency Travel Insurance
Not Included:
- International airfare and any domestic flights
- Visa fees (tourist visa required)
- Vaccination fees
